Game Introduction
Alphabetic Train is an educational puzzle-clicker game designed for young learners. In this game, a friendly turtle rides a train holding a board with a letter. Your core objective is to help the turtle collect pictures that start with that letter, reinforcing letter-to-word connections in a fun, interactive way. The game blends learning with entertainment, making it ideal for children who are beginning to explore the alphabet. With colorful graphics and simple mechanics, it offers a safe and engaging environment for kids to practice early literacy skills while enjoying a playful train adventure.
How to Play
Players typically tap the screen when a picture that starts with the letter shown on the turtle's board passes directly over the turtle. Collecting the correct picture adds to your progress toward a target number of alphabetic cards. Incorrect pictures reduce health, so careful timing is important. The game also includes bonus cards that provide extra fuel or health, green cards that boost your score, and red cards that decrease your score. The game ends if the train runs out of fuel or health reaches zero. Players can choose a target of 25 or 100 alphabetic cards to win.
